Software Developer Intern - EFI (May 2018 - Jan 2019)
Interpolated YAML and XML messages with C++ and Python to support localization within printer UI. Transformed XML documents into HTML using XSLT. Connected to MySQL database to keep track of languages currently in
use. Migrated python2 code to python3. Analyzed log dumps using matplotlib plotting tool for python.
Responsible for back-end fixtures on companies internal and external websites. Developed and maintained browser tests using Laravel Dusk framework.
Undergradute Teaching Assistant - UNH (Aug 2017 - Dec 2018)
Undergraduate Teaching Assistant (UTA) for the Computer Science Department. Assisted students in labs and taught recitations in Java and Python on Data Structures.
Software Developer Intern - Allegro MicroSystems LLC (May 2017 - Jan 2018)
Created a GUI in Python with the PyQt4 module to generate Verilog code using Jinja2, used to model electronic systems. Developed a project management tool which was used to keep several local git repositories up to
date with its remote, automatically. Converted legacy tcl scripts into class based Python scripts. Worked with git on a daily basis in a Debian environment.
Ran conformance and interoperability testing on various vendor equipment according to IPv6 standards in a Unix environment. My duties included but are not limited to; using ssh or telnet to connect to various host
and routers, recording WireShark captures for ping test results, contacting vendors via email throughout the testing process and troubleshooting device testing failures.